About the Book
Personal ads are today’s singles bars. More people than ever are
finding dates and mates from the personals.
“ADVERTISING FOR LOVE” teaches singles how to use personal
ads more effectively.
“ADVERTISING FOR LOVE,” by David Kronheim, is a light-hearted
journal, covering one year of the author’s search for a wife through
the personal ads, dating services, and matchmakers. It features
many humorous anecdotes, along with some touching stories.
This book has a very upbeat and cheerful tone. It shows that if
you have a positive attitude, and a good sense of humor, using
personal ads and dating services can be a rewarding experience,
despite the occasional date from hell.
There is a section offering advice on writing your own ad,
responding to ads, and meeting safely.
David Kronheim’s writing on personal ads and singles issues has
been published in New York Magazine, and in various newspapers.
He has also been host of a radio program for singles.
About the Author
David Kronheim is an advertising copywriter and marketing analyst. He is a published author on the subject of personal ads, and has hosted a radio program about dating and single life. David has a B.A. in Communications, an M.B.A. in Marketing, and is a native of New York.
